00 / 00 Marshall Frady, Win Stracke in conversation with Studs Terkel BROADCAST: Jun. 14, 1979 | DURATION: 00:52:09 Synopsis Discussing Billy Graham and revivalism with author and journalist Marshall Frady and singer and musician Win Stracke.
